Nikon Z6 II Mirrorless Camera with 24-70mm Lens VOK060XA review

The Nikon Z6 II is a near-perfect update to an already impressive predecessor, so there's a lot to like and not much to be concerned about. If you'd like a rugged, reliable, all-around full-frame mirrorless camera, The Z6 II should be at the top of your list.

Incredible image quality; Impressive autofocus performance; Solid build quality; Professional features & functions; Comfortable ergonomics/grip; Strong all-around value

4K 30p could have been 4K 60p; un-cropped; Focus point control & subject tracking implementation could be improved; Button layout quirks not changed from previous model

Nikon Z6 II Mirrorless Camera with 24-70mm Lens VOK060XA review

The Nikon Z 6II is a versatile camera with a 24.5-million-pixel BSI-CMOS full-frame sensor which can record video up to 4K Ultra HD at 60fps. Its next-generation autofocus system can work in light levels as low as -4.5EV, while two EXPEED 6 processing engines provide faster image processing and a...
